Ex-Met Darling owes $545G in back taxes
Meet the Mets -- and the tax man? The IRS and tax agencies in two states, including New York, have former Mets pitcher Ron Darling in their crosshairs. Darling, who helped call the Yankees-Twins game this past Sunday on TBS in his capacity as a TV analyst, owes $544,197 in state and federal ...

Ron Darling Owes The IRS Quite A Bit Of Money
awfulannouncing.blogspot.com 10/13/2009 — In these times it would be understandable if the average American got behind with the tax money they owed to the IRS, but for someone who pitched 13 years in the majors and is a full-time analyst to owe over $500K is a different story. According to ...
